The Morning Journey Begins
Your day starts early, with a hotel pickup at 5:00 AM from Pokhara Lakeside. Yes, it’s a very early start—this is when the mountains are still shrouded in darkness and the world is quiet. But that early rise is necessary to catch the sunrise over the Himalayas, and, frankly, it’s part of what makes this experience special. The drive from Pokhara to Sarangkot covers around 45 minutes and offers a chance to see the city waking up as the scenic mountain road winds upward.
During the ride, you’ll enjoy glimpses of scenic views along the way—a gentle reminder that Nepal’s natural beauty is never far away. Some reviews note the scenic drive as a highlight, with travelers appreciating the off-road adventure that adds a bit of excitement before your main event.
Arriving at Sarangkot
Once at Sarangkot, you’ll have a brief opportunity for photo stops—a chance to snap the panoramic Himalayan panorama before the crowds arrive. The early morning light lends itself to stunning photos of snow-capped peaks, including Annapurna and Dhaulagiri. The quiet and cool mountain air heighten the sense of adventure.
Champagne Breakfast with a View
After soaking in the mountain scenery, you’ll settle into the Sarangkot Mountain Lodge for a luxurious breakfast. Imagine gourmet treats served with a glass of sparkling champagne, all while surrounded by panoramic views of the Himalayas. It’s a surprisingly elegant way to start the day. Many reviews praise the breakfast as “delicious” and “a perfect complement” to the adventure ahead.
This is a key part of the experience because it offers a moment of calm and indulgence—something you might not expect in a mountain adventure. The view from the lodge is stunning enough to make you forget about the early wake-up call, and it sets the tone for the excitement to come.

The main event is the Sunrise ZipFlyer, which lasts about 1 minute—but that’s plenty of time to feel your stomach do a flip or two. The zipline is positioned to give you a thrilling descent with incredible Himalayan views in the background. The sensation of flying through the mountain air, with the rising sun casting golden hues over the peaks, is truly unforgettable.
Many reviewers describe the zipline as “heart-pounding” and “absolutely worth every second.” The experience is designed to be accessible, with a small group of limited participants (up to 10), ensuring you get plenty of attention and guidance from your instructor. The ride is safe, with professional instructors guiding you through the process, and videos/photos are included, so you’ll have lasting memories of your flight.
Return and Reflection
After the zipline, you’ll enjoy a scenic drive back to Pokhara Lakeside. The entire experience, including transport, breakfast, and the zipline ride, takes about one hour of actual flying time, but the whole morning might span around 4-5 hours with travel and breaks.
What to Expect and What’s Not Included
This tour is well-planned to maximize your Himalayan sunrise experience. The hotel pickup ensures a hassle-free start, and the small group size makes for a more intimate atmosphere. You’ll be guided by English-speaking instructors who keep everything clear and fun.
What’s included is straightforward: champagne breakfast, hotel pickup, the zipline experience, and photos/video. You’ll want to bring comfortable shoes, warm layers (early mornings in Nepal can be chilly), and your camera to capture the vistas.
What’s not included? Any additional activities beyond the scheduled experience and personal gear. The tour states that smoking, alcohol, and drugs are not allowed—common safety rules but worth noting.

Frequently Asked Questions
What time does the tour start? The pickup is at 5:00 AM, but check availability for specific start times as they may vary.
How long does the experience last? The zipline itself lasts approximately 1 minute, but the entire morning including breakfast and travel spans around 4-5 hours.
Is it suitable for children or older travelers? The tour is limited to small groups and is best suited for those comfortable with heights. Not recommended for pregnant women or those afraid of heights.
What should I bring? Comfortable shoes, warm clothing, and a camera are recommended to prepare for early morning mountain weather and to capture the experience.
Are there any safety concerns? The activity is guided by professional instructors, and safety measures are in place. The experience is considered safe for most participants.
Can I cancel if my plans change?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und.
What is included in the price? Champagne breakfast at Sarangkot Mountain Lodge, hotel pickup, zipline experience, and photos/video.
What’s not included? Additional activities or personal gear.
